Control

Some pests are difficult to control, particularly those that fly, sting, carry disease, or destroy food or other plants. Biological controls such as parasites, predators, and pathogens help manage pests. These natural enemies can be introduced to a pest population, though there is often a lag between the increase in enemy numbers and the decrease in pest populations. Altering the environment by changing soil conditions, for example through mulching or steam sterilization, can also control some pests.

Physical methods of pest control kill or block the pests, and include traps, screens, barriers, and fences. Devices that change the environment, for example through radiation or electricity, can also be used to control some pests.

Pest proofing a home or building can be a cost effective way to deal with an existing problem. This includes sealing cracks and crevices, caulking or plastering where needed, installing weather stripping on doors and windows, putting in drain screens for sinks and tubs, and repairing torn window screens. It also includes removing food and water sources by clearing garbage regularly and storing it in sealed containers.

Using baits to kill pests is a common form of chemical pest control. They are designed to minimize the risk of people ingesting poison and can be very effective for some pests. They can be especially helpful in situations where pests are hiding in hard-to-reach places, like behind the fridge or under the kitchen sink.

Chemical pesticides can also be used to kill or block a pest, but should only be applied in accordance with the pesticide’s label instructions and safety warnings. These chemicals should be kept out of the reach of children and pets.

Detection

A pest problem can cause food contamination, property damage, and discomfort to people and pets. It can also be costly if you have to dispose of contaminated goods or lose money because you are not able to sell your produce.

The earlier pests are detected, the more effective preventive and control measures will be. In some cases, pests can be difficult to identify and may be hard to distinguish from non-infesting animals. For example, the young of some species of insects look different from mature adults and can be very similar to weed seedlings. Incorrect identification of pests can lead to the wrong type of management tactic being used.

Detecting pest problems can be done through regular scouting, identifying, and assessing pest populations and their damage. This can help you decide whether or not pest control is necessary. It can also provide valuable information about the pest, such as its life cycle and population dynamics.

Non-living evidence that you may have a pest infestation can include droppings, urine stains, nesting materials, chew marks, and damage. For example, gnaw marks on furniture or electrical wires can indicate a rodent or termite problem. Finding shredded paper or fabric in odd places can also be an indication that rodents are around, while uneven grass lengths and circular brown patches on the lawn may signal a mole problem.

Depending on the pest, early detection of pests may be assisted by monitoring for pheromones or other signs in or near the pest habitat. The use of electronic sensors that monitor temperature, movement, moisture and sound may also improve detection.

In addition to scouting, the use of insect traps is an important tool in pest detection. The state’s statewide network of traps helps protect home gardens, local agricultural crops, and parks from unwanted pests such as exotic fruit flies (particularly species of Bactrocera, Dacus, Ceratitis and Anastrepha), Japanese beetle, light brown apple moth, khapra beetle, spongy moth, and flighted spongy moth. Identifying these pests as early as possible reduces the need for chemical pest controls.

Integrated pest management, or IPM, is an ecosystem-based strategy that uses non-toxic methods to keep pests away from homes and business and avoids the need for chemical controls. In IPM, long-term prevention is achieved through a combination of techniques such as habitat manipulation, modification of cultural practices, and biological control. Pesticides may be used only after monitoring indicates they are needed, and only when the target pest is present and at a level that will result in unacceptable harm. The Military Humvee – More Than Just a Light Truck

Known by the acronym HMMWV, the aluminum-bodied Humvee became the icon of half a dozen US military interventions. It conquered foreign battlefields and suburban soccer fields, but it’s now entering a new phase of its life. Contact Street Legal Exports now!

The Defense Logistics Agency, which manages the sale of surplus equipment, received an official determination from the Department of State and Commerce stating that two of the earliest models, the M998 and the M1038, can be sold without the restrictions of export control laws.

The military Humvee, or HMMWV as it’s known, is more than just a light truck. The multi-purpose vehicle satisfies several different needs within the military, including cargo transport vehicles, patrol vehicles, ambulances, and shelter carriers. It’s also a powerful combat vehicle that can be armed to the teeth with everything from a pop-up gun turret to a TOW antitank missile and even a helicopter-launched Hellfire missile.

The Army’s jack-of-all-trades light utility vehicle was developed in the 1970s after the service realized it needed better-performing vehicles to deal with new threats like IEDs (improvised explosive devices) and car bombs. The military-drafted specifications for a new light vehicle that could replace its fleet’s M151 Jeep, M561 Gama Goat, and other 4×4 trucks. Three companies were awarded contracts to produce prototypes for testing and AM General was the winner.

After undergoing numerous modifications, the Humvee was rolled out in 1984 and has since been used in many campaigns worldwide. The funny-looking workhorse has conquered mud, sand and rocks and even snow. It’s climbed over mountains, pulled trailers on the highway and evaded detection in deserts and jungles. The versatile light vehicle has sat inside the belly of CH-53s and been slung from helicopters to be dropped in hostile territory.

Military Humvees are essentially just light trucks with some extra armor. They are capable of carrying more weight than standard vehicles and can climb 60 percent incline and traverse 40 percent slopes. They can also ford 2.5 feet of water without a snorkel and 5 feet with one.

The vehicle has a robust chassis and four-wheel drive and can carry up to 18,000 pounds. Its engine can be upgraded to a more powerful and fuel-efficient model. It has an automatic transmission and a full suspension that ensures it can handle off-road obstacles.

It’s Armored

HMMWVs are designed to fill several needs in the military, including light cargo transport, patrol vehicle, ambulance and service truck. They also serve as armored personnel carriers. When it comes to defending soldiers from the threat of roadside bombs, however, even uparmored Humvees can fall short. The problem is that the vehicle was originally built to be lighter and less expensive than other vehicles of its kind, requiring it to sacrifice some level of protection in order to meet performance requirements.

The military has had to hastily uparmore select HMMWVs for the Iraq War, and the new Joint Light Tactical Vehicle is replacing front-line Humvees in the United States. Unlike the uparmored Humvees, the new JLTV is designed from the ground up to protect its passengers. Its internal components are separated from the engine, so an explosion under the vehicle doesn’t directly send vibrations through to the occupants.

In addition to providing better protection, the new vehicles are also expected to be cheaper to buy and maintain than uparmored Humvees. They use less fuel, require fewer maintenance hours, and have more options for customization. The Army plans to offer three different versions of the JLTV, with each configured for a particular function.

One of the reasons that the JLTV is expected to be more durable than uparmored Humvees is that it doesn’t have any electronic engines, brakes or other controls that an enemy could hack with malware, scramble with directed microwaves or fry with an electromagnetic pulse. The underlying aluminum frame is also more rigid than the original Humvee’s fiberglass parts, which are more susceptible to damage in a crash.

Backflow preventers

Backflow preventers are essential plumbing devices that protect your home’s water supply. They ensure that water only flows in one direction, preventing the backflow of potentially dangerous contaminants. These devices are required by law in homes, buildings and public utilities. Backflow contamination incidents can result in serious health problems, which is why they are so important to avoid. These incidents can occur when there are sudden changes in pressure, causing the water to flow backwards. If this happens, the backflow could contaminate the drinking water supply with soap, chlorine, human waste, toxins and more. Backflow preventers are designed to prevent this backflow, protecting the health and safety of your family.

Backflow prevention is a critical part of the plumbing industry. Backflow events can lead to disease, illness, and even death. This is why it is so important to maintain these devices properly and keep them inspected. In addition, it is crucial to educate yourself about backflow prevention so that you can be an active participant in the protection of your community’s water supply.

The most common type of backflow preventer is the air gap device. It works by creating a physical separation between the container and the water source. It is a simple and inexpensive way to reduce the risk of contamination. It is also an effective solution for many applications, including kitchen sinks and bathtubs. However, there are a few things to keep in mind when installing an air gap.

Another type of backflow prevention is the reduced pressure zone backflow preventer (RPZ). It consists of two check valves and a monitor chamber that monitors backpressure. This type of backflow preventer is best for high hazard backflows. The RPZ can be more expensive than other backflow prevention systems, but it is still an affordable option for high-risk applications.

The Importance of Proper Pest Detection and Control

Pests can cause significant damage, making them a serious health hazard. For example, fleas carry bacteria that can cause disease in humans and pets. Pests can also disrupt production by contaminating crops. Contact Nature Shield Pest Solutions now!

Some natural forces affect the number of pests, such as climate, natural enemies, natural barriers, availability of shelter and food, and water sources. These factors help to reduce the need for pest control.

Identifying pests is one of the most important parts of practicing Integrated Pest Management (IPM). Correctly identifying pests can help determine whether or not they need to be controlled and allow you to select effective control methods.

When identifying a pest, it is important to consider its biology and environmental factors. Is it a continuous pest that needs to be managed year-round, or is it a sporadic problem that should be treated only when damage occurs? Also, do pests have a particular “window of opportunity” in which they are more susceptible to being controlled? For example, weeds are often easier to control when they are in their seedling stage or early in the season before they become established. For insects, it is sometimes easiest to manage them when they are immature or in their egg-laying stages.

Most pests leave some kind of damage behind that can help you determine what type they are. For example, caterpillars make distinctive holes in leaves, and weevils chew around the edges of leaves. Other signs that indicate what type of pest is attacking a crop include slowed growth, distorted leaves or fruits, and deformed flowers.

There are also several insect identification resources available online, such as the insect encyclopedia or an app that uses AI photo recognition technology to instantly identify insects. These resources can be helpful when trying to identify a pest for yourself, but it is always best to consult an expert to make sure you have the right identification.

If you are unsure of what type of pest you have, contact your local County Extension IPM personnel or a certified pest control professional. They can help you with the identification process, and they may be able to provide you with recommendations for a pest control strategy that will work for your specific situation.

In some cases, the identification of a pest can help you decide to use a nontoxic method of control instead of applying a chemical. For example, a nematode spray may be an effective way to control fleas and grubs without using harmful chemicals. Nematodes are microscopic worms that live in the soil. They can be helpful, such as the roach-eating nematode Steinernema carpocapsae, or harmful, such as the fungus nematode Meloidogyne racemosa.

Treatment

Pest control involves reducing the number of pests to an acceptable level to reduce damage or create a safer environment. Pests include rodents, insects, weeds, and other organisms that can cause health risks or property damage. Pests can also spread diseases or contaminate food supplies. Pest control is a complex issue that includes prevention, suppression, and eradication.

Identifying the pest is the first step in any control method. This allows a professional to tailor the management approach to the specific pest. It is also essential to understand a pest’s biology and life cycle. This information helps to determine when pesticides are needed and when they are not. It can also help to discover nonchemical methods that will be more effective than pesticides.

Natural enemies—parasites, predators, and pathogens—often suppress pest populations. The weather affects both the activity and growth of many plant-eating pests. A drought or extreme cold can dramatically decrease the population of insect pests in fields and gardens.

Landscape features like mountains and bodies of water restrict the movement of many pests. Clutter and sloppy gardening practices provide places for pests to hide or breed. Regularly empty trash cans and regularly clean surfaces to remove hiding places. Eliminate or at least regularly clean up sources of water for pests, including puddles and overflowing bird feeders.

Some pests can be controlled with nonchemical methods, such as eliminating or at least limiting the availability of water and food, changing irrigation practices, or adding barriers that block pests. If these are not effective, chemical controls may be needed.

In an integrated pest management (IPM) system, prevention is a key element. Pesticides are used only after monitoring indicates they are needed according to established guidelines. The use of pesticides is a last resort and is always used with the goal of minimizing risk to human beings, beneficial and natural organisms, and the environment.

What to Look For in a Mini Storage Facility

Mini Storage facility offers colored garage-bay-looking units that vary in size and quality. They are usually located in rural or urban communities and rent to individuals.

Mini Storage

Mini storage facilities serve many different customers. Whether you’re moving into a new home or simply need to make room, these spaces are great for personal use.

The sizes of Mini Storage units vary and there are many different choices for customers to consider. The size of your belongings and how much space you need will help determine which unit type is best for you. There are also a variety of contracts and periods to choose from. It’s important to look for a facility that offers flexible terms, as this will help you save money.

The smallest standard unit is the 5’x5’ unit, which is roughly the size of a closet and can accommodate items such as seasonal clothes, sporting equipment and a few boxes. This size is popular with college students looking to store their dorm room belongings over the summer, as well as individuals who need a small amount of extra storage space.

Medium storage units include the 10’x10’ and 10’x15’ options. These are the most common and can fit furniture from a one-bedroom apartment or office, along with a sofa, tables, chairs, appliances and boxes. They are also ideal for people who are moving or renovating their homes and need a temporary solution for their furniture and home décor.

Larger storage units include the 20’x20’ and 20’x30’ types. These are the largest units offered and can hold larger furniture pieces, bicycles, kayaks, and more. These are great for people who need a lot of space or want to store items that are too large to fit into their garages.

Education requirements

The path to becoming a lawyer can vary, but in the United States, it usually begins with an undergraduate degree. Students pursuing a bachelor’s degree should consider studying subjects like English, History, or Political Science. These subjects will help future lawyers develop a broad understanding of society, which is crucial for legal research and writing. They will also learn critical thinking skills and gain analytical perspectives that will help them understand legal problems.

After completing a bachelor’s degree, the next step is to attend law school. Typically, a Juris Doctor program lasts three years and provides a comprehensive education in the legal system. It includes courses on constitutional law, contracts, criminal law, and torts. Moreover, students are exposed to a variety of practical experiences by participating in clinics and externships. These opportunities give them hands-on training in the legal field and help them build a network of professional connections.

In addition to a rigorous legal curriculum, law school also offers specialized programs that cater to particular areas of law. Students can also opt for joint degrees that combine a JD with another advanced degree in areas such as business or public health. These degrees are increasingly popular among law school graduates, who can use the dual credentials to pursue a variety of career paths.

A law degree opens the door to a variety of careers, including private practice and government service. It can also prepare individuals for careers in lawmaking, policy-making, and academia. In addition, a legal degree can provide a stepping stone for entrepreneurs interested in starting their own businesses or consulting firms.

Some alternative paths to a legal career include apprenticeships or law office study, but these options can be time-consuming and difficult for aspiring lawyers. Additionally, apprentices often have a lower pass rate on the bar exam than law school graduates. Therefore, it is important to choose the right school for your future career in the law.
